Python에서 활성 창 가져오기
문제: Python을 사용하여 화면의 활성 창에 어떻게 액세스할 수 있나요? ? 예를 들어 이 창은 라우터의 관리자 로그인 인터페이스일 수 있습니다.
해결책:
Windows에서는 Windows용 Python 확장(pywin32)을 사용하여 다음을 수행할 수 있습니다. 활성 창을 얻습니다. 방법은 다음과 같습니다.
<code class="python"># Python 2 from win32gui import GetWindowText, GetForegroundWindow print GetWindowText(GetForegroundWindow())</code>
<code class="python"># Python 3 from win32gui import GetWindowText, GetForegroundWindow print(GetWindowText(GetForegroundWindow()))</code>
예:
아래 코드는 화면에 활성 창의 제목을 인쇄합니다.
<code class="python">import win32gui window_handle = win32gui.GetForegroundWindow() window_title = win32gui.GetWindowText(window_handle) print(window_title)</code>
위 내용은 Python에서 활성 창을 프로그래밍 방식으로 검색하는 방법은 무엇입니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!